Alright, so not too long ago, I was trying to wire up my gauges and I was cutting into some wires so I could use a test light to find ones with 12V of power. well, I was using a razor blade to cut into the wires, and I accidentally cut two wires at once and they started smoking. well, ever since then, my alarm hasn't worked, and also my doors will lock and then immidietly unlock themselves randomly while I'm driving and it's very annoying! and the more and more I look at things, the more convinced I am that I do not have the stock alarm. I traced the two wires that I shorted together as the red and black wires that go to this switch:
IPB Image
this is the switch that turns my alarm on and off. I haven't figured out where the other ends of the wires go to yet.

Here is what the sensor for my alarm looks like:
IPB Image
it says "clifford magnetic resonance sensor" so I'm guessing this is not the stock alarm? it was held in place with zip ties... I don't think toyota would zip tie it's alarm sensors in place. anyway, coming from this unit are a red, black, and orange wire. The red wire goes and then goes into a crimping splicer thing where about 3 other red wires go to all join to one thickish red wire. don't know that this is. the black wire does the same thing, where about 3-4 black wires join into a splicer into two black wires. orange wire splices into another orange wire, which I don't know where that goes yet either.

I also found this:
IPB Image
it's a clear box with electronic gizmos in it, like capacitors and resistors, that sort of thing. it has a red, black, and orange wire coming from it too, and it's also held in place by zip ties leading me to believe it's also aftermarket, anyone know what it is? it's located kinda behind where the dimmer switch is.

any help would be appreciated. Such as, possible things I could have blown out to make the alarm stop working (the little LED on the sensor still lights up evertime it senses a vibration.) I already checked all my fuses. also, what could be causing the doors to lock and then unlock randomly while driving (Usually happens when I do something else, like rolling down the window, turning on my headlights, or pushing the brake pedal)
